Output d511f13de421ce8b014667660256b9dd9dd0c2cdb92460bd671921ea9288fdd3:19

value
2908000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 759f7b44b0e250f264466987d0b9facdf4425d1e OP_EQUAL
address
3CQx2xWrtgFq1LpqXZAFJLgGvaRq68MSBw
transaction
d511f13de421ce8b014667660256b9dd9dd0c2cdb92460bd671921ea9288fdd3